摘要

Simultaneous measurement of fission fragments and prompt neutrons following the thermal neutron induced fission of U-235 has been performed in order to obtain the neutron multiplicity (ν) and its emission energy (η) against the specified mass (m~*) and the total kinetic energy (TKE). The obtained value of - dv/dTKE(m~ *) showed a saw-tooth distribution. The average neutron energy <η>(m *) had a distribution with a reflection symmetry around the half mass division. The measurement also gave the level density parameters of the specified fragment, a(m~*), and this parameters showed a saw-tooth trend too. The analysis by a phenomenological description of this parameters including the shell and collective effects suggested the existence of a collective motion of the fission fragments.
